Rectors of the Parish Church of St Giles, Pitchcott

In 1847 George Lipscomb in his "The History and Antiquities of the County of Buckingham" listed the following Rectors for Pitchcott:

---- Osbert
1267 William de Eston
1272 William de Luda
1274 Lucasius de Broc
---- John de Teynton
1310 Robert Ostage
1318 John le Arches
1329 Simon le Waleys
13-- John de Fresingfield
1337 Thomas de Stamerdene
1348 Robert de Colston
1349 William de Daventre
1369 William de Harleston
1397 John Drewe
1401 John Woburn
1408 Thomas Seaman
1416 John Carter
1449 Thomas Maryner
1456 Thomas Alford
1460 William Wooton
1466 Henry Franceys
1467 Robert Trysthorp, or Frysthorpe
1469 William Aleby
1507 Robert Lyne, alias Lyons
1531 William Castell
1540 Thomas Thirkill
1557 Edward Audlesare, A.M.
1575 Robert Walkeden
1620 Matthew Walkeden
1633 Henry Walkeden
1658 Nathaniel Netmaker
1680 Thomas King, A.M.
1685 Henry Atkinson
1724 Henry Bruges, A.M.
1727 Worsep Atkinson
1762 Thomas Lally, A.M.
1771 James Mead, Clerk
1773 Thomas Bourne, A.B.
1787 William Hughes, A.M.
1822 William R. Freemantle, A.M.
